The Evolution of Car Key Technology


To understand car key programming, one should initially understand the innovation ingrained within modern keys. Considering that the mid-1990s, manufacturers have incorporated electronic parts into keys to enhance security.

1. Transponder Keys

Presented to prevent “hot-wiring,” transponder secrets consist of a small RFID (Radio Frequency Identification) chip inside the plastic head of the key. When the key is turned in the ignition, the car's Engine Control Unit (ECU) sends an electronic signal to the key. If the chip in the key responds with the right digital code, the engine begins. 2. Remote Fobs and Keyless Entry

These devices enable drivers to lock, unlock, and periodically begin their vehicles from a distance. They operate on specific radio frequencies that must be integrated with the vehicle's receiver.

3. Smart Keys and Proximity Fobs

The most advanced level of key innovation, smart keys enable “push-to-start” performance. The car detects the presence of the key by means of distance sensing units. These require the most intricate programming due to the rolling codes used to avoid “relay attacks” by tech-savvy burglars.

How Car Key Programming Works


Car key programming is the procedure of syncing a new, blank electronic chip to a specific vehicle's ECU. When a service technician programs a key, they are not simply cutting metal; they are entering the vehicle's software system to “introduce” the brand-new key as a trusted gadget.

The Technical Process

Most professional services follow a standardized procedure to guarantee the brand-new key functions flawlessly with the car's security infrastructure:

  1. Diagnostic Connection: The service technician connects a specific programming tool to the vehicle's OBD-II (On-Board Diagnostics) port, typically found under the dashboard.
  2. System Access: Using exclusive software application, the specialist bypasses or enters the automobile's security layer. This frequently requires a “PIN code” or “Security Code” specific to that Vehicle Identification Number (VIN).
  3. Wiping Old Data: If a key was taken, the service technician can erase the old key's digital signature from the car's memory, making sure the lost key can no longer begin the engine.
  4. Signal Synchronization: The brand-new key is placed in the ignition or a designated “key pocket.” The programming tool transmits the synchronization information to the ECU.
  5. Confirmation: The technician checks all functions, including the transponder start, remote lock/unlock, and panic buttons.

Why Professional Service is Essential


While the internet has plenty of “DIY car key programming” tutorials, modern encryption makes self-programming progressively difficult and risky. High-end brands like BMW, Mercedes-Benz, and Audi make use of “rolling codes” that change every time the key is utilized. Trying to set these without professional-grade diagnostic equipment can result in a “lockout state,” where the ECU freezes the ignition system completely as a theft-prevention measure.

The Future of Car Key Programming: Digital Keys


As the industry moves forward, we are seeing a shift toward “Phone-as-a-Key” (PaaK) innovation. Vehicles from manufacturers like Tesla and Ford now permit users to configure their smart devices as the main car key using Bluetooth Low Energy (BLE) and Ultra-Wideband (UWB) innovation.

However, even this technology requires professional setup and secure “handshaking” procedures to avoid cyber-hijacking. For the foreseeable future, the competence of car key programming professionals will remain a foundation of automobile security.

Regularly Asked Questions (FAQ)


1. Can I program a car key myself?

For some older automobiles (pre-2010), makers included a “manual override” sequence (e.g., cycling the ignition five times). Nevertheless, for almost all contemporary lorries, a specialized OBD-II programming tool and software are required.

2. What information do I need to offer a programming service?

The professional will generally need the car's make, model, and year, in addition to the Vehicle Identification Number (VIN) and proof of ownership (registration or title) to guarantee the service is being performed for the rightful owner.

3. Will programming a new key disable my old one?

Not necessarily. Specialists can pick to “add” a key or “erase and reprogram.” If you still have your initial keys, the professional will just include the brand-new one to the car's list of licensed devices.

4. For how long does the programming process take?

Many secrets can be programmed in 15 to 30 minutes once the technician has actually accessed to the automobile's software application. Some high-security European designs might take longer due to data-processing hold-ups built into their security systems.

5. Why is my key fob not working even after a battery change?

If a battery passes away entirely, the fob may lose its “sync” with the car. In this case, it requires a “re-sync” or a full reprogramming service to restore communication with the ECU.
